There are nearly half a million children in the United States who are living in foster care. Many of these children and youth have intellectual disabilities, which can make it difficult for them to maintain stable placements within their communities
If you are thinking about opening your home to a foster child with an intellectual disability, know that you have the power to make a tremendous difference in their life. By providing them with love, support, and understanding, you can help them thrive.
